<038> Thesis:   Why is it that we cannot live with a certain level of ambiguity in the Bible? Introduction:  As we come to our time of study this morning, we are faced with a puzzle. The first piece of the puzzle is the question of the content of the text (what did Luke write?). The second piece of the puzzle is the question of what really caused Mary's reaction (what caused Mary to be so agitated?). And the third piece of the puzzle is the question of why Luke put this puzzle before us (upon what did Luke want Theophilus to dwell as he considered this record?). Therefore, we are going to see if we can begin to make a picture come together this morning by attempting to put the pieces of the puzzle together correctly.
